The river banks and villages of Suffolk have been made famous by two great artists - John Constable (born 1776) and Thomas Gainsborough (born 1726). Here time has stood still despite modern farming practices and urban development. The sweet villages, quietness and ease that nurtured their artistic genius and inspired so many powerful works are still there, surprisingly unchanged. Prosperity came to the region through the wool trade in the 14th century, which left a legacy of sumptuous architecture, with splendid churches in towns and villages that seem too small and remote to support such magnificence.
ITINERARY
Monday - Morning departure from Dorset to Sevenoaks, the quintessential English market town with a great variety of shops and cafes for lunch. Continue to Ufford Park this afternoon where dinner awaits.
Tuesday - Visit Framlingham, a charming village with a unique high street leading to a historic castle (Ed Sheeran' s "Castle on the Hill") - stay for lunch. This afternoon to Snape maltings, a centre for arts, crafts, galleries and shops set in a breathtaking expanse of reeds, water and sky. There are way-marked paths that lead you to explore this unique landscape full of diverse wildlife. Finally call into the seaside town of Aldeburgh - pastel coloured 19th century villas line the promenade and on the pebble beach fishermen still sell their catch from their huts.
Wednesday - The morning is spent in historic Ipswich with its stunning new waterfront, historic buildings and peaceful parks. There are galleries, ghosts, boutiques, bistros, museums and merchants houses in the county town. Lunch is taken in Woodbridge, an historic riverside village - streets lined with traditional buildings lead to a waterfront with a working tide mill - the gem in Suffolk's crown. This afternoon we shall join a 2 hour boat cruise on the River Deben - An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ty with rich wildlife and history.
Thursday - A full days tour through Constables unchanging countryside - visiting East Bergholt, his birthplace. Later to Flatford Mill on the River Stour - the subject of his most famous painting. Continue to Sudbury, birthplace of Thomas Gainsborough and a busy market town. After lunch call into Lavenham with its narrow alleyways, independent shops and gaily coloured skewwhiff half- timbered buildings.
Friday - Homewards bound with a stop in Reigate for lunch. Return to Dorset late afternoon.
